He thought that was a strenuous growth on the <br />City. <br />Mayor Sonterre stated that issue is on the agenda for this meeting. <br />Doris Holman, 3034 Ardimore Ave. questioned the availability of information off the web site. <br />She said the agenda is not on the web site for this meeting, and that has happened repeatedly. <br />Also, when the web page was relocated, minutes from the year 2000 disappeared. She stated that <br />if the City is going to promote the use of the web site for city information, then it should be kept <br />up. <br />Mayor Sonterre explained that the City has joined forces with Roseville several months ago. Our <br />city is using their server. Mounds View doesn't have a dedicated web maintenance individual at <br />the time. Mr. Ericson has spent some time maintaining the web page, but his duties have <br />overtaken the time he could volunteer on the web page. The City is looking for someone to take <br />that job over. Mayor Sonterre offered to check with Patrick about the cable portion of the <br />meetings being put on the web site, and suggested Ms. Holman request the agenda be emailed to <br />• her for each meeting. <br />Ms. Holman stated she was here four months ago on the one-year anniversary of her stepson's <br />death on Highway 10 in front of the City Hall.
